Описание тега edge-to-edge

0 ответов

Получение вставок в ViewCompat при применении прослушивателя окна возвращает разные значения в API 30

Привет всем, я ищу некоторое представление об этой проблеме, я пытался обработать размещение нижнего компонента на экране, который при переключении показывает / скрывает панели навигации системы. я использовал ViewCompat.setOnApplyWindowInsetsListen…
1 ответ

Как реализовать вставки системных панелей с навигацией жестами от края до края?

Я пытаюсь добавить элементы от края до края для панели навигации с помощью жестов в приложение Tip Time от Google . Я добавил прозрачныйnavigationBarColorТег XML дляthemes.xmlа также следующий код дляonCreate()функцияMainActivity.kt: Это было напрям…
29 сен '22 в 22:28
2 ответа

Compose: как настроить заполнение ime и Scaffold с отступом от края до края, а windowSoftInputMode is AdjustResize

Отступ ошибочно добавляет отступ панели навигации, даже когда открыта программная клавиатура, добавляется отступ IME, что приводит к двойному количеству отступов панели навигации (см. снимок экрана ниже, разделитель должен касаться верхней части про…
1 ответ

PaddingValues ​​кроме bottomPadding в Jetpack Compose

Проблема Я ищу способ изменить , чтобы они не включалиBottomPadding. Моя текущая реализация выглядит так, но здесь мне нужно пройтиLayoutDirection, что кажется действительно неуклюжим. fun PaddingValues.exceptBottomPadding(layoutDirection: LayoutDir…
0 ответов

Как наблюдать за появлением systemBars в Compose

Я пытаюсь прослушать появление системных панелей, поэтому я могу скрыть их через ограниченное время (чтобы вернуться к иммерсивному представлению), я могу скрыть и показать системные панели, но не могу кажется, что они эффективно наблюдают за внешни…
0 ответов

Зачем нам нужны другие методы для обеспечения сквозной работы в Android, в то время как window.setFlags to FLAG_LAYOUT_NO_LIMITS всегда выполняет всю работу

Чтобы обеспечить современный вид моего приложения, я хочу сделать его сквозным. Благодаря некоторым исследованиям я знаю, что мы можем достичь этого в 3 этапа: Сделайте так, чтобы макет приложения распространялся на весь экран. Чтобы сделать это с п…
27 окт '23 в 20:30
1 ответ

Как определить, что Edge-to-Edge включен?

Как определить в моем фрагменте, что в активности включена сквозная функция с функцией Есть идеи? Можно ли получить значениеWindowCompat.setDecorFitsSystemWindows(window, false)?
0 ответов

Edge to Edge в AndroidX показывает панель действий – как ее скрыть?

я реализовалEdge to Edgeв моем приложении для Android я сделал панели состояния/навигации прозрачными, и это работает хорошо. Однако внезапноActionBarпоявилось в верхней части моего экрана, хотя я установил тему приложения на"android:Theme.Material.…